微信小程序填表功能实现指南
摘要:本指南介绍了微信小程序中实现填表功能的方法和步骤。通过详细阐述微信小程序的填表功能,包括表单元素的设计、数据收集和处理等方面,为读者提供了实用的指导和建议。本指南旨在帮助开发者了解如何在微信小程序中创建有效的填表功能,从而为用户提供便捷的数据输入和提交体验。通过遵循本指南的步骤,开发者可以轻松地实现微信小程序中的填表功能,并有效提高用户体验和数据处理效率。
在当今的数字化时代,微信小程序已经成为了我们生活中不可或缺的一部分,其丰富的功能和便捷的使用体验吸引了大量的用户,填表功能作为小程序中常见的交互方式之一,对于用户信息的收集和数据处理具有重要的作用,本文将详细介绍微信小程序填表功能的实现过程,帮助开发者快速掌握相关技巧。
需求分析
在开发微信小程序填表功能前,首先要明确需求,明确需要收集哪些信息,表单需要包含哪些字段,以及如何处理用户提交的数据,这些信息将有助于你设计合理的表单结构和布局。
设计表单结构
在设计表单结构时,需要考虑以下几点:
1、字段设计:根据需求,确定需要收集的字段,如姓名、电话、邮箱等。
2、布局设计:根据小程序的设计规范,合理布局表单,确保用户体验。
3、验证规则:设置必要的验证规则,如必填项、格式校验等,确保数据的有效性。
实现表单功能
在实现表单功能时,需要利用微信小程序提供的组件和API,以下是一些常用组件和API的介绍:
1、form表单:用于包裹表单内的所有元素,实现表单的提交功能。
2、input输入框:用于用户输入信息,支持多种类型,如文本、密码等。
3、picker选择器:用于用户选择数据,如日期、时间、地区等。
4、按钮:用于触发表单的提交事件,如提交、重置等。
5、wx.request:用于向后端发送数据,处理用户提交的信息。
在实现过程中,需要处理以下几个关键事件:
1、表单提交:当用户点击提交按钮时,获取表单内的数据,并向后端发送。
2、数据验证:在提交前对数据进行验证,确保数据的合法性和完整性。
3、错误提示:对于验证不通过的数据,给出相应的错误提示。
优化用户体验
为了确保良好的用户体验,可以采取以下措施:
1、提示信息:对于每个字段,给出相应的提示信息,告诉用户如何填写。
2、自动聚焦:当页面加载时,将焦点自动聚焦到第一个输入框,方便用户操作。
3、分步提交:对于长表单,可以设计为分步提交的方式,降低用户的填写压力。
数据保存与处理
当用户提交数据后,需要进行数据的保存与处理,开发者可以根据需求选择将数据保存在本地或上传到服务器。
1、本地保存:对于一些不需要长期保存的数据,可以将其保存在小程序的本地存储中。
2、服务器保存:对于需要长期保存或涉及多用户共享的数据,需要将其保存到服务器,在服务器端进行数据的进一步处理和存储。
测试与调整
完成开发后,需要进行测试与调整,测试表单的功能是否正常,数据是否准确传输,用户体验是否良好等,在测试过程中,需要发现问题并及时调整。
微信小程序填表功能的实现需要考虑到多个方面,包括需求分析、设计表单结构、实现表单功能、优化用户体验、数据保存与处理以及测试与调整等,只有全面考虑并处理好这些方面,才能开发出功能完善、用户体验良好的小程序填表功能,随着小程序的不断发展和普及,未来将有更多的功能和API供开发者使用,使得小程序填表功能的实现更加便捷和高效。
与本文内容相关的文章: